{Sugar Bee} Vampirina Sugar Cookies for Alivia's 4th Birthday

This past weekend a sweet and beautiful, little girl named, Alivia, turned 4! Her mama, who happens to be my niece, planned a special day filled with the birthday girl's favorite character, Vampirina. If you aren't familiar with Vampirina, it is one of the newest cartoons on the Disney Junior channel. She is a little girl vampire who moves from Transylvania to Pennsylvania with her mom and dad, and they open a Bed and Breakfast. Vee (Vampirina) is the new kid in town and must face the trials, tribulations, and joys of fitting in with her very human classmates. It is a super adorable show and little girls are going batty over it!

However, because this cartoon is fairly new, there is a lack of Vampirina party decorations in the stores, thus, I was asked to make cookies that would allow her to bring the theme of the party into the decor. I must admit that I am not a cookie decorator that prides herself on character cookies, they are on the difficult side and can be very time consuming, but of course for Alivia, I was up for the challenge!
What I came up with was the perfect combination of characters and spooktacular patterns! I decided that I would try my hand at Vampirina and her friend, Demi. Instead of doing characters with their entire bodies, I placed Vampirina's face on a plaque cookie with a cute gray bat pattern. Demi's face was placed on a balloon, also with a bat pattern, but in a pretty purple. I wanted to include a festive birthday cake, so I created a purple cake with black drip frosting topped with some red and pink sprinkles. On the side of the cake I added a spider web pattern and a cute bat to represent Vampirina in bat form. Lastly, I like to incorporate some personalization so I made bat cookies and piped Alivia's name on them. I also created number 4 cookies with a spiderweb pattern and a purple bat since that is age she was turning.
